Hey guys and girls. I’ve been wanting to finish leveling my Druid and to play as feral. But I seem to be having a hard time properly playing the blood talons build.
Am I supposed to always have blood talons rolling by using three different generators in a row all the time? Or do I need to get blood talons to proc then use two finishers and rinse and repeat like that?

Build them and then use them. If you don’t use both before gaining bloodtalons again, you’ve wasted one of the stacks.
Think about it a different way. You want every single one of your finishers to be cast with Bloodtalons, and you don’t want to use a suboptimal builder unless you need to in order to get Bloodtalons. You should only need to do this every other CP cycle since one sequence gives you three charge of BT.
You will occasionally have times when you naturally proc BT such as when you need to use Rake, Swipe, and BT close together. If this overcaps your BT don’t stress it too much. It happens from time to time and isn’t the end of the world. But you should only deliberately trying to activate BT when you don’t have any stacks.
Remember as well that you don’t want to overcap CP when activating BT. So the best time to activate BT is when you have 0 CP since that’s the only way to not overcap CP too much regardless of how many abilities you crit (you’ll overcap 1 CP if all 3 crit but that’s normal.) Which means you want to make sure you pool energy in order to be able to cast all your abilities quickly enough when that happens.
Final thing to remember… Finishers WILL NOT break your chain if you still cast all your builders quickly enough. In most cases this has limited practical applications but it does mean that when you’re in Berserk it’s still possible to cast every finisher with BT while also not overcapping CP, but you need to shift your thinking to cycles in pairs rather than cycles individually.
This is the optimal way to do it yes, but often in raid encounters you will refresh simply because you need to spend your OOC proc on refreshing Thrash and it also happens to be close enough or past Pandemic to refresh Rake before going back to Brutal Slash or Shred.
Honestly, don’t worry about “wasting” BT procs. You’ll mostly get BT naturally by maintaining Rake/Thrash and keeping Brutal Slash on recharge while mainly using Shred. The exception is having to go out of your way to refresh BT during Zerk, but usually you can get away with that by dumping an OOC proc on Thrash and wanting to refresh Rake anyway to maintain the stealth bonus.
TLDR: Worry about maintaining bleeds more and keeping Brutal Slash on recharge and you’ll naturally trigger BT most of the time anyway.

I would stay away from those addons for something like feral, they don’t work that great for it from what I’ve seen. I tested one out when I saw a buddy use it for ret pally, but it’s clunky and the spell you need to cast changes so frequently with the timers running out or needing to build BT.
You can get a weak aura that will help to track your spenders and how much time you have left to trigger BT, as well as BT charges.
